WebKURT function SharePoint Server Subscription Edition SharePoint Server 2024 More... Returns the kurtosis of a data set. Kurtosis characterizes the relative peakedness or flatness of a distribution compared with the normal distribution. Positive kurtosis indicates a relatively peaked distribution.
